Abstract

The utility model belongs to the technical field of water filtration, and provides a simple filter, which comprises a filter cylinder, wherein the side wall of the filter cylinder is provided with a water outlet hole; the filter comprises a filter element, wherein the side wall of the filter element is provided with a plurality of bulges and recesses which are alternately arranged along the axis direction, the side wall of the filter element is provided with a plurality of filter holes, the filter element is arranged in a filter cylinder, and a circulation channel is formed between the side wall of the filter element and the inner wall of the filter cylinder; the inlet pipe is arranged at one end of the filter cylinder and is communicated with the filter element; the outlet pipe is arranged on the side wall of the filter cylinder and is communicated with the filter cylinder through the water outlet hole; the sealing plate is arranged at the other end of the filter cylinder and used for sealing the openings at the end parts of the filter cylinder and the filter element, and a drain valve used for discharging impurities is arranged on the sealing plate. Through above-mentioned technical scheme, the problem that Y type filter tube filter area is little, the filter effect is not good among the prior art has been solved.

Background
The Y-filter is an indispensable filtering device for medium conveying pipeline system, and is often installed at the inlet end of pressure reducing valve, pressure relief valve, level valve or other equipment to remove impurities in the medium, so as to protect the normal use of the valve and equipment. Most of the existing Y-type filters are provided with an input port and an output port on the same central axis of a valve body, a side pipe communicated with the inside of the valve body is obliquely arranged between the input port and the output port on the valve body, a cylindrical filter element is arranged in a side cylinder, and a port is arranged at the lower end of the side cylinder and is connected with a valve cover in a sealing manner.

As shown in the figures 1-4 of the drawings,
a simple filter comprising:
the filter cartridge 1 is provided with a water outlet hole 11 on the side wall of the filter cartridge 1;
the filter cartridge comprises a filter cartridge 2, wherein the side wall of the filter cartridge 2 is provided with a plurality of bulges 21 and recesses 22, the bulges 21 and the recesses 22 are alternately arranged along the axial direction, the side wall of the filter cartridge 2 is provided with a plurality of filter holes 23, the filter cartridge 2 is arranged in a filter cartridge 1, and a circulation channel is formed between the side wall of the filter cartridge 2 and the inner wall of the filter cartridge 1;
an inlet pipe 3, wherein the inlet pipe 3 is arranged at one end of the filter cartridge 1 and is communicated with the filter element 2;
the outlet pipe 4 is arranged on the side wall of the filter cartridge 1 and is communicated with the filter cartridge 1 through a water outlet hole 11;
and a sealing plate 5, the sealing plate 5 being provided at the other end of the filter cartridge 1 for closing the openings of the ends of the filter cartridge 1 and the filter element 2.
In the embodiment, the filter element 2 is arranged in the filter cartridge 1, the side wall of the filter element 2 is provided with the filter holes, water flows into the filter element 2 from the inlet pipe 3, the water flows to the closed end at the end part of the filter cartridge 1 and flows into the flow channel between the side wall of the filter element 2 and the inner wall of the filter cartridge 1 from the filter holes 23 on the side wall of the filter element 2, and finally flows out from the outlet pipe 4 through the water outlet hole 11, when the water flows through the filter holes 23 on the filter element 2, impurities in the water flow, the diameter of which is larger than that of the filter holes 23, are filtered by the filter element 2 and separated from the water flow, in the filtering process, because the side wall of the filter element 2 is provided with the protrusions 21 and the depressions 22 which are alternately arranged in the axial direction, the filter element is corrugated, the filtering area of the whole filter element 2 is enlarged, water flows out from, all parts are regular elements, so that the manufacturing and the installation are convenient, and the production cost can be effectively reduced.
Further, the projection 21 and the recess 22 are provided along the circumferential direction of the filter element 2.
In this embodiment, protruding 21 and sunken 22 set up along the circumference of filter core 2, and filter core 2 is the bellows form, and intensity is with high, reduces the harm that rivers strikeed, and rivers have enlarged when flowing in filter core 2 with the area of contact of filter core 2, and effective filter area is bigger.
Further, the protrusion 21 and the depression 22 are spirally arranged.
In this embodiment, the protrusion 21 and the recess 22 on the filter element 2 are spirally arranged, and when water flows in the filter element 2, the water flow is influenced by the protrusion 21 and the groove, and the water flow flows along the spiral, so that the flow resistance can be reduced, and the filtering efficiency and the filtering effect can be improved.
Furthermore, the outlet pipe 4 and the filter cartridge 1 are arranged at an acute angle, and the water outlet hole 11 is oval.
In this embodiment, the outlet pipe 4 and the filter cartridge 1 are obliquely arranged and face the water flow direction along the oblique direction, the water outlet hole 11 at the interface is oval, the area of the outlet hole is larger than that of the outlet hole in a circular shape, and the oblique water outlet pipe can also reduce the resistance of water flow, so that the filtering resistance is further reduced.
Furthermore, the water outlet hole 11 is provided in a plurality,
still include communicating pipe 6, communicating pipe 6 is a plurality ofly, through apopore 11 with strain a section of thick bamboo 1 intercommunication, outlet pipe 4 and a plurality of communicating pipe 6 intercommunications
In this embodiment, set up a plurality of apopores 11 and a plurality of 6 intercommunications of communicating pipe, 6 connect outlet pipe 4 and outlet pipe 4 intercommunications communicating pipe, enlarge effective filter area through setting up a plurality of exports, promote the filter effect.
Further, the outer diameter of the protrusion 21 of the filter element 2 at the water outlet hole 11 is the same as the inner diameter of the filter cartridge 1.
In this embodiment, the protrusion 21 of the filter element 2 on the side wall of the water outlet hole 11 is the same as the inner diameter of the filter cartridge 1, the flow channel is formed between the recess 22 and the inner wall of the filter cartridge 1, water flows out from the outlet pipe 4 in the flow channel, the structure is stable, and the filter element 2 is not easily deformed when receiving water flow impact.
